Transaction ffe037bad1ce606b20a8f3ac83041ce4f60518be16ae3aa490e28e0a8b39f619
1 Input
1 Output
-
ffe037bad1ce606b20a8f3ac83041ce4f60518be16ae3aa490e28e0a8b39f619:0
- value
- 42559609
- script pubkey
- OP_0 OP_PUSHBYTES_20 77915372ff620bd02205e99a9862fe2d8ed52391
- address
- bc1qw7g4xuhlvg9aqgs9axdfsch79k8d2gu3zsgn2t